We are seeking a highly organized and detail-oriented individual to join our team as an Associate Managing Editor. In this role, you will play a crucial part in the management of our prestigious journals, overseeing key functions like peer-review management.

As an Associate Managing Editor, you will have the chance to work on exciting projects including special issues, priority publications, and podcasts. You will also collaborate closely with the Managing Editor, assisting with budget preparations and monitoring throughout the year.

Remote candidates welcome or primary location in Alexandria, VA.

Responsibilities

  • Assist Managing Editor with budget preparations and monitoring of the budget throughout the year
  • Manage regular and periodic collection and distribution of data and statistics such as editor report cards, monthly/quarterly editor meetings, editorial board performance, annual submissions, and ad-hoc reports for the editors
  • Monitor competitor and leading biomedical journal products, editorial standards, and services and suggest ideas to maintain ASCO journals at an equivalent or higher level
  • Review and monitor journal website to ensure consistency across sites
  • Manage and oversee special projects (e.g., oversee journal-specific social media activities)
  • Provide direct support to volunteer Editor-in-Chief, including oversight of editors’ queue work and quarterly editor meetings
  • Represent Journals department at ASCO meetings and cross-departmental initiatives
  • Identify areas for collaboration across journals where possible
  • Keep current with best practices along with industry standards and trends
  • Other duties in support of the journals as assigned

Required Education and Experience

  • Bachelor’s degree in arts or science or equivalent years of experience
  • 4 – 5 years’ experience in scholarly peer-review management
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office, specifically Excel, PowerPoint, and Outlook
